XD-IT Services Ltd
  • Home
  • About us
  • Services
  • Contact us
  • Help & Support

Register

Login

Menu

  • Home
  • About us
  • Services
  • Contact us
  • Help & Support

Contacts

Info@xdit.co.uk
+44(0)121 392 9183

Contact us

Socials

  • Facebook
  • LinkedIn

XD-IT Services Ltd

© 2024